Why is This Prediction Reasonable?
Detailed mechanism of action data was not retrieved for this evidence pack (DG002, High severity). Based on the α4-integrin/VLA-4 pathway referenced in the pack’s own rationale text, natalizumab blocks lymphocyte adhesion and migration across endothelial barriers — a mechanism explored in airway inflammatory disease (e.g., asthma) but with no established treatment rationale for bronchitis.
The evidence pack’s own analysis for this candidate is explicit that the prediction is not well supported: bronchitis is predominantly infectious or irritant in etiology, blocking lymphocyte trafficking has no therapeutic rationale for it, and the resulting immunosuppression could plausibly increase infection risk. The pack flags this as a suspected knowledge-graph mis-connection through the respiratory/inflammation node cluster rather than a genuine mechanistic signal.
For context, the pack’s lower-ranked candidates (psoriasis, parapsoriasis, acute lichenoid pityriasis) are supported only by case-report literature in which natalizumab induces or aggravates dermatologic disease during MS treatment — the opposite therapeutic direction — with one isolated case report of comorbid psoriasis improving. None of the five ranked candidates in this pack currently have positive, disease-directed clinical evidence.

Safety Considerations
Please refer to the package insert for safety information.
Note: this pack’s safety block (key warnings, contraindications, DDI) is fully a data gap (DG001, Blocking). Separately, literature surfaced while researching other ranked candidates (psoriasis) repeatedly documents progressive multifocal leukoencephalopathy (PML) as a serious class-level risk associated with natalizumab — this is not sourced from the formal safety fields but should be flagged for any follow-up safety review.
